Abstract
The utility model relates to a street lamp which is characterized by convenient installation, low electrical loss and low possibility of damage of storage batteries. The street lamp comprises an electricity generating device; a top bracket connected with the electricity generating device; a leg bracket arranged at the other end of the top bracket; an accommodating device used for placing at least one storage battery and arranged between the top bracket and the leg bracket; a luminous device arranged on one side surface of the leg bracket; wherein the accommodating device is formed by mutually buckling two casings respectively connected with the top bracket and the leg bracket; a pivoting mechanism endowing the accommodating device with movable rotary opening/closing functions is arranged in the position of the periphery where the two casings are buckled; and a controller is electrically connected with the electricity generation device, the luminous device and the storage batteries, and is used for controlling power storage/supply of the storage batteries.
